// Author: Gockner, Simon // Created: 2021-04-08 // Copyright(c) 2021 SimonG. All Rights Reserved. using System.Collections.Generic; using Lib.Audio.Interfaces; using Lib.ProcessManaging.Interfaces; using NAudio.CoreAudioApi; namespace Lib.Audio.Factories { public interface IControllableFactory { IControllable Create(List audioSessionControls, IObservedProcess? process, string name); IMasterControllable Create(AudioEndpointVolume audioEndpointVolume, string name); } }